Loving freedom and always fascinated by all those involved in innovation, it was natural that Alina(lalala) became interested in the metaverse.
She decides to create her first digital series “NFT-WTF” using photos taken with her phone: of her daughter, of the street, but also simple screenshots... of what gives her a emotion whatever it may be.
These photos are reworked on a computer to create a metaphor for the digital lens through which we view our lives. She questions these virtual and societal innovations: do they create a “superficial” human connection far from true perception, or have they modified it?
Alina (lalala), who has been exploring duality for years, decides to go even further in her research, by bringing the real world into dialogue with that of the metaverse and vice versa.
